The Renault Megane IV Sedan 1.5 Blue dCi (95 Hp) is a compact sedan produced by the French automaker Renault between 2018 and 2020. Part of the fourth generation of the Megane series, this model was primarily aimed at the European market, where the sedan body style remained popular. While the Megane has been sold in various forms in the United States previously, the fourth-generation sedan was not officially offered. This version focused on fuel efficiency and practicality, offering a diesel powertrain in a segment increasingly dominated by gasoline engines and, more recently, hybrid and electric options.

Engine & Performance
The Renault Megane IV Sedan 1.5 Blue dCi is powered by a 1.5-liter inline-four cylinder diesel engine, designated K9K 872. This engine produces 95 horsepower at 3750 rpm and 240 Nm (177.01 lb.-ft.) of torque at 1750 rpm. The engine utilizes a turbocharger with an intercooler to enhance performance and efficiency. Fuel is delivered via a diesel commonrail injection system. The engine’s relatively small displacement and turbocharging contribute to its fuel-efficient operation. Power is sent to the front wheels through a six-speed manual transmission. Performance figures include a 0-100 km/h (0-62 mph) acceleration time of 12.1 seconds and a top speed of 185 km/h (114.95 mph). The 0-60 mph time is calculated at 11.5 seconds. The weight-to-power ratio is 13.9 kg/Hp, and the weight-to-torque ratio is 5.5 kg/Nm.
Design & Features
The Megane IV Sedan features a contemporary design language, characterized by sculpted lines and a dynamic profile. The sedan body style offers a more elongated silhouette compared to the hatchback, providing a larger trunk capacity. Inside, the Megane IV boasts a modern interior with a focus on ergonomics and technology. Standard features typically included air conditioning, power windows, central locking, and an audio system. Higher trim levels offered features such as a touchscreen infotainment system, navigation, and advanced driver-assistance systems (ADAS). Safety features, crucial in modern vehicles, included ABS (Anti-lock Braking System), electronic stability control, and multiple airbags. The sedan offers seating for five passengers and features a 503-liter (17.76 cu. ft.) trunk, expandable to 987 liters (34.86 cu. ft.) with the rear seats folded down. The vehicle’s dimensions are 4632 mm (182.36 in.) in length, 1814 mm (71.42 in.) in width, and 1443 mm (56.81 in.) in height.
